WebThe All Terrain Anti-Aircraft (AT-AA) was a quick moving, quadrupedal, mobile anti-aircraft walker used by the Galactic Empire. The AT-AA had four stubby legs and lizard-like locomotion, along with a low profile not seen in other Imperial walkers, this made them harder targets for aircraft.
